From 35ab1c31ecb17acbde5b6414861b8a2fc3d3247c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E4=B8=89=E5=92=B2=E6=99=BA=E5=AD=90=20Kevin=20Deng?= Date: Tue, 8 Nov 2022 10:14:10 +0800 Subject: [PATCH] types: use actual type for script block ASTs (#6457) --- packages/compiler-sfc/src/parse.ts | 10 ++-------- 1 file changed, 2 insertions(+), 8 deletions(-) diff --git a/packages/compiler-sfc/src/parse.ts b/packages/compiler-sfc/src/parse.ts index cc7873c29a8..5c7d3b8e80e 100644 --- a/packages/compiler-sfc/src/parse.ts +++ b/packages/compiler-sfc/src/parse.ts @@ -44,14 +44,8 @@ export interface SFCScriptBlock extends SFCBlock { setup?: string | boolean bindings?: BindingMetadata imports?: Record - /** - * import('\@babel/types').Statement - */ - scriptAst?: any[] - /** - * import('\@babel/types').Statement - */ - scriptSetupAst?: any[] + scriptAst?: import('@babel/types').Statement[] + scriptSetupAst?: import('@babel/types').Statement[] } export interface SFCStyleBlock extends SFCBlock {